Healthcare Recruitment in Prisons
Dear Oxleas NHS Foundation Trust,
Question 1
Please can you confirm what your total spend on agency staff used in prisons was during the financial year 2018-19?
Can you please break this financial information down by specialism:
• Nurses
• GPs
• Healthcare Assistants
• Pharmacists
• Prison Officers
• Counsellors
Question 2
Please can you confirm the names of the organisation/s you procure temporary professionals for these roles from?
To provide additional clarity on my request, ‘temporary Professionals’ is to mean all persons who are working within a prison and are not on permanent contracts of employment with the Prison, but are supplied via employment agencies.
